Saturday was National HIV Testing Day, and as part of the national effort to get out the message to take an HIV test regularly, D.C. Mayor Adrian Fenty taped this PSA with HHS Secretary Kathleen Sebelius.
Here’s the transcript for the spot:
Sebelius: I’m Kathleen Sebelius, Secretary of the U.S. Department of Health and Human Services.
Fenty: And I’m Adrian Fenty, the Mayor of Washington DC.
Sebelius: Every nine and a half minutes someone in the U.S. becomes infected with HIV.
Fenty: To find a testing site near you, text your ZIP code to “KNOWIT” – that’s “5-6-6-9-4-8” – or visit HIVtest.org.
Sebelius: “Take the Test, Take Control.”
Voiceover: To learn more visit AIDS.gov. This message is from the U.S. Department of Health and Human Services.
